    I have owned many factory sealed Sega Genesis systems over the years. None have ever had tape running down both sides. Just because you buy something from a store doesn't mean the store didn't open it and reseal it. The sticker on the side is also not something from Sega and looks like a store or liquidator sticker. Putting all of that aside, even if this was factory sealed and mint (clearly this isn't mint based on your photos with dents and scuffing all over the box), you're probably looking at a couple of hundred bucks tops. This is the later Sega Genesis 2 version and not the more in demand original V1 console. There is a guy on Ebay selling mint factory sealed Sega Genesis 2 core units for around $150 right now. The X-men tie in makes it more interesting, but not hundreds of dollars more interesting.

    Looks like a new variant, it would be cool for you to share the photos in this thread over on Sega Retro
    http://segaretro.org/Mega_Drive_cons..._North_America

    It looks like an official Sega job, the NFR sticker on the XMEN cart was a common practice for these bundles, as was just giving you the cart and manual, not the full clamshell. I am assuming the callout text on the front bottom right of the box is a sticker as well right? Normally they just took regular M2 sets and tweaked them a bit, then stuck a sticker on the front. Never seen a shirt bundled in though.
